Two Big East heavyweights meet on Wednesday night as 15th ranked Connecticut hosts 16th ranked Pittsburgh in a game that can be seen on ESPN 2. The Panthers are 3-0 in the conference while Connecticut is 2-2 so this is a critical early NCAA Basketball Betting season conference matchup for the Huskies. These two teams have played some great games though the years but recently Pittsburgh has had the edge, winning three of the last four.
Connecticut is a 6.5 point favorite at SBG Global.
Pittsburgh and Connecticut lost a lot of talent from last year but both teams seem to have reloaded well. The Panthers were not picked at the top of the Big East this season but Jamie Dixon has built a power at Pittsburgh. Connecticut lost its top three scorers from last year but they do have Jerome Dyson and he is scoring 19.3 points per game which is third best in the Big East.
Pittsburgh has been led this year but Ashton Gibbs who is averaging 22 points per game in league play. “We’ve been doubted this whole season, from the start,” said Gibbs. The key for Pittsburgh is shooting the ball as they are 12-0 when they shoot at least 40% from the field. “It’s just getting better,” coach Jamie Dixon said. “I think they’re improving. I think there’s a real understanding that we’re not going to be the same team in January that we were in November.”
Connecticut is coming off a very tough loss on Saturday as they blew a 19 point lead to Georgetown and lost 72-69. “It’s the most heartbreaking loss this year. It’s not even close,” head coach Jim Calhoun said, “We took our 20 minutes of work, threw it away and said, ‘OK, now let’s play an even game.’”
